Scheduler - Surrey Home Support
Fraser HealthSurrey, British Columbia, CA- Full-time
Detailed Overview
Under the general supervision of the Manager or designate, coordinates and maintains the scheduling of designated Home Health / Home Support (HH / HS) staff to ensure provision of services to clients and compliance with relevant legislation; in collaboration with team members, initiates and updates schedules; relays information to HH / HS staff and clients; maintains accurate relevant documentation. Responsibilities Prepares and adjusts schedules for designated Home Health / Home Support (HH / HS) staff to meet client needs, client referrals, applicable collective agreement and care plan including daily, short and long term scheduling; contacts staff regarding the initiation or changes in schedules; documents cancellations, amends schedules, monitors and adjusts schedules to maintain regular hours of work. Records and obtains client intake information; relays information to HH / HS staff; informs client of regular scheduled service time and any change in service personnel or time of service. Receives client feedback, complaints and inquiries; defers to other members of the health team regarding specific feedback, inquiries and complaints and / or changes in client's status / schedule; advises Manager or designate of any difficulties in the placement of Community Health Workers (CHW). Receives calls and / or requests from staff regarding absences such as vacation, sick leave and other leaves of absence; assigns staff in accordance with applicable collective agreement upon approval of leave. Liaises with Manager or designate regarding issues such as staffing requirements and client concerns; reviews and verifies CHW timesheets and provides input into performance review of CHW'''s, as requested. Completes and maintains client records / reports ensuring that all information for the delivery and evaluation of service is complete; maintains relevant statistical information as required. Orientates new office staff to scheduling procedures and forms, as required. Performs other related duties as assigned. Qualifications Education and Experience Grade 12, plus an Office Administration Certificate and two years' recent related experience, or an equivalent combination of education, training and experience. Skills and Abilities Ability to communicate effectively, both verbally and in writing. Physical ability to carry out the duties of the position. Ability to work independently and in cooperation with others. Ability to operate related equipment. Ability to plan, organize and prioritize. Ability to type at 20 wpm. Business writing skills. Knowledge of office procedures. Knowledge of medical terminology. Ability to analyze and resolve problems.
